Thomson Reuters is seeking a motivated and resourceful Sales Development Representative to generate leads for their sales team for Accelerator (SafeSend & SurePrep). The role involves engaging prospective customers, developing relationships, and assisting Sales Executives in closing new business through various communication channels.
Responsibilities
- Over a myriad of communication channels - outbound phone calls, email, and video – reach out to both cold and warm leads, to contact decision makers in prospective customer firms, to introduce them to SafeSend and our suite of solutions
- Develop ongoing relationships with prospective customers by being a resource, demonstrating a good understanding of our key products, and communicating effectively (oral and written)
- Cultivate and nurture prospects to advance them from unknown status to an appointment with a Sales Executive or scheduled product demo
- Be creative and unique in outreach efforts that drive hand raising opportunities
- Make outbound phone calls to prospective customers to collect information and set or confirm appointments
- Use social media best practices and networking skills to connect with and engage prospective customers
- Work with our talented Marketing team on new methods to reach prospective customers and get the word out
- Assist Sales Executives in customer and prospective customer follow-up
- Strive for meeting and exceeding targets for contacts made, appointments set, relevant information collected, and overall sales pipeline growth with the ultimate goal to aid in bringing on new business
- Be curious and motivated to deliver top-notch job performance and then potentially springboard into other roles in the organization
Skills
- Excellent communication skills, both verbal and written
- Good at storytelling, capturing interest, and engaging customers and prospective customers in a compelling way
- Fast learner with a demonstrated aptitude to learn new skills and topics related to client collaboration technology
- Strong time management and organization skills
- Team player with good collaboration and listening skills
- Driven and passionate about achieving goals and moving the needle
- 1-2 years in outbound-focused sales or other customer-oriented roles/internships (support, customer service, etc.)
- Knowledge of the public accounting space or professional tax preparation is a plus
- SDR/BDR experience is a plus but not required
- Salesforce CRM experience is a plus but not required
